
1973
Spencer Haywood finishes with 51 points and 18 rebounds to lead the SuperSonics to a 107-100 victory over the Kansas City Kings. It’s a career high for Haywood, who also becomes the first player in SuperSonics franchise history to top 50 points in a game and sets the franchise single game record, which stood for just one year before getting broken by Fred Brown.
1964
Cheryl Miller is born in Riverside, California. At Riverside Polytechnic High School, she set the California state records for most points in a prep season and most points in a prep career.
1981
Austin Carr has his jersey #34 retired by the Cavaliers. Nicknamed “Mr. Cavalier,” Carr was the franchise’s first superstar and has since spent decades working for the team as a scout and broadcaster.
1986
Nikola Pekovic is born in Bijelo Polje, Montenegro (then Yugoslavia). He represented the Montenegrin national team at the 2011 EuroBasket and is currently the federation’s president.
1992
Doug McDermott is born in Grand Forks, North Dakota. His father, Greg, was an assistant coach at the time at University of North Dakota and later coached Doug at Creighton.
2021
Stephen Curry scores 62 points in a 137-122 Warriors win over the Trail Blazers. It was the highest single game point total by a Warriors player since Rick Barry’s 64-point game in 1974.
